In a concerning development, Jharkhand’s Education Minister Ramdas Soren suffered serious injuries at his residence. Doctors deemed his condition critical and recommended advanced treatment in Delhi.
He is currently being airlifted from Jamshedpur to the national capital and will undergo treatment at Apollo Hospital. The exact cause of the injury remains unclear, but officials confirmed his health situation requires specialized care.
Family members and government officials are closely monitoring his condition. The incident has caused widespread concern across the state, with citizens and political leaders expressing hopes for his swift recovery.
Further updates are awaited as doctors in Delhi assess his health and decide the next course of treatment. The state government has assured all necessary support for the minister’s medical care.
